Understanding UPVC Windows and Doors: A Comprehensive Guide
UPVC (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ride) windows and doors have garnered substantial attention over the past couple of decades, becoming a popular option amongst homeowners and contractors alike. Known for their resilience, energy efficiency, and low upkeep requirements, UPVC items use a number of advantages over traditional materials like wood or metal. This post will look into the benefits, features, setup procedures, and upkeep ideas related to UPVC doors and windows.
What is UPVC?
UPVC means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ride, a kind of rigid plastic that is frequently utilized in building and construction. Unlike PVC, UPVC does not include plasticizers, making it more robust and resilient. This material has actually ended up being a staple in the window and door market due to its residential or commercial properties such as weather resistance, thermal insulation, and soundproofing capabilities.
Key Features of UPVC Windows and Doors
Before considering UPVC windows and doors, it's vital to comprehend their crucial functions:
1. Durability and Longevity
UPVC items are resistant to rot, deterioration, and fading. Unlike wood, they do not warp or fracture due to weather modifications, guaranteeing years of hassle-free usage.
2. Energy Efficiency
UPVC windows and doors boast excellent insulation homes, decreasing energy expenses by reducing heat transfer. This can result in a more comfy indoor environment and considerable cost savings on heating and cooling costs.

3. Low Maintenance Requirements
One of the piece de resistances of UPVC is its low maintenance nature. Cleaning up includes just soap and water, with no requirement for painting or sealing.
4. Security Features
Modern UPVC windows and doors come geared up with advanced locking systems and multi-point locks, enhancing the security of homes.
5. Visual Flexibility
UPVC doors and windows are available in numerous styles, colors, and surfaces, permitting homeowners to pick designs that match their architecture.
6. Ecologically Friendly
UPVC can be recycled without losing its structural properties, contributing positively to ecological sustainability.

Installation Process for UPVC Windows and Doors
The setup of UPVC doors and windows is an important procedure that needs accuracy and proficiency. Here is a step-by-step guide:
- Measurement: Accurate measurements are important for choosing the right-sized UPVC window or door.
- Removal of Old Windows/Doors: If replacing, the old windows or doors should be thoroughly gotten rid of to avoid damaging the surrounding walls.
- Preparation of the Opening: Ensure that the opening is clean, dry, and structurally noise. Examine for leakages or drafts that could cause issues.
- Installation of Window/Door Frame: The UPVC frame is fitted into the opening, guaranteeing it is leveled and plumb.
- Sealing: An appropriate sealant, typically silicone-based, is applied around the area between the frame and the wall to prevent air and water infiltration.
- Fitting Windows/Doors: The glazing units are added to the frames, and doors are hung using suitable hinges.
- Last Checks: Operate all doors and windows to guarantee they open, close, and lock efficiently. Examine for any spaces or leaks.
Upkeep Tips for UPVC Products
Maintaining UPVC windows and doors is simple and requires minimal effort. Here are some essential maintenance pointers:
- Clean Regularly: Use warm, soapy water to clean up the frames and glass at least two times a year.
- Inspect Seals and Gaskets: Regularly inspect the seals and gaskets for any indications of wear and tear. Change if required.
- Lubricate Locks and Hinges: Apply a silicone spray lubricant to locks and hinges to preserve smooth performance.
- Clear Drainage Slots: Ensure that drainage slots (if present) are devoid of particles for efficient water expulsion.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Are UPVC windows energy-efficient?
Yes, UPVC windows have outstanding insulation homes, considerably decreasing heat loss throughout winter season and keeping homes cool in summer season, adding to lower energy bills.
Q2: Do UPVC windows included a warranty?
Many UPVC window manufacturers provide warranties that generally vary from 5 to 20 years, covering production defects and efficiency.

Q3: Can UPVC windows be painted?
It's usually not suggested to paint UPVC windows as it can void service warranties. Instead, think about picking a color that matches your home when acquiring.
Q4: Are UPVC doors protect?
UPVC doors come with multi-point locking systems that provide enhanced security. They are typically tested to satisfy strict security standards.
Q5: How long do UPVC windows and doors last?
With proper maintenance, UPVC doors and windows can last for 20 to 30 years and even longer.
